机器视觉系统优化与应用实践深度学习算法图像识别技术
机器视觉系统优化与应用实践(深度学习算法、图像识别技术)
1. 什么是机器视觉?
机器视觉是一门科学,它使计算机能够通过摄像头或其他传感器捕捉和分析图像数据。这种技术的核心在于使用计算来模拟人类的视觉过程,以便实现对环境的理解和反应。随着深度学习技术的发展,机器视觉变得越来越强大,其在工业自动化、医疗诊断、安全监控等领域的应用日益广泛。
2. 什么是深度学习?
深度学习是一种特殊类型的人工神经网络,它通过构建多层次抽象特征以从大量数据中学习模式。这些模型可以用于各种任务,如图像分类、目标检测和语义分割。在机器视觉领域,深度学习算法被广泛使用,因为它们能有效地处理复杂场景并准确识别对象。
3. 如何进行机器视觉培训?
为了使我们的模型能够高效工作,我们需要进行适当的训练。这通常涉及到收集并标注大量示例数据,然后将其用作模型训练的一部分。此外,还需要选择合适的架构,并调整超参数以优化性能。此外,对于特定任务,可能还需要开发新的算法或者改进现有的方法。
4. 深度学习在哪些方面提高了图像识别能力?
由于其强大的表示能力,深层神经网络已成为现代图像识别中的金标准。它们能够从原始输入如RGB颜色值开始,从而逐步提取出更高级别的特征,这对于复杂场景下的物体识别至关重要。此外,由于其灵活性,可以轻松扩展到新任务或场景,只需重新训练一小部分参数即可。
5. 如何解决常见的问题,比如过拟合和欠拟合?
过拟合发生在模型记忆了训练集,而不是学到了通用的模式时;而欠拟合则是在没有足够信息的情况下无法准确预测输出。这两种情况都可能导致性能不佳,因此我们需要采取措施避免它们。一种策略是增加更多样化且具有代表性的数据集,同时减少过多相似的输入;另一种策略是在保持性能上的平衡时,不断地交叉验证不同模型配置。
6. 未来的发展趋势是什么?
随着硬件成本降低以及软件库丰富,我们可以预见未来几年内,特别是在推理速度上取得显著提升。在同时,更精细的情感智能也会被引入,使得计算机不仅仅能看懂事物,还能理解他们之间如何相互作用,从而进一步增强决策质量。在这个不断变化和进步的大背景下,对待未来发展保持开放的心态至关重要。